    1 Card file of walks. (Joint activities of the teacher with the children for a walk in the summer).

    2 CARD 1 1. Birdwatching. 2. Purpose: to consider the appearance of birds: the body is covered with down, feathers. There are wings, beak, paws, tail, eyes. Continue bird watching on the site, learn to name the main parts of the body. Bring up careful attitude to the birds 3. D / s: How do birds sing? Purpose: development auditory perception and articulations. 4. Game exercise: Who is next? Purpose: to teach long jump from a place. 5. Labor order. show how to rake sand into a pile with shovels, transfer it in buckets to the sandbox. Purpose: to instill elementary labor skills in children. 6. P / n: Birds in nests. Purpose: to teach children to walk and run in all directions, without bumping into each other, to teach them to act on the signal of the teacher. 7. D / n: Where is it warmer in the sun or in the shade? Purpose: development of tactile and temperature sensations. For example: sand, asphalt, pebbles.

    3 8. Independent play activity. Purpose: to teach children to play together, to share toys. Roll strollers and play balls carefully, without bumping into each other. CARD 2 1. Observation of the state of the weather. Purpose: to clarify with the children the state of the weather: fine day, hot, warm, blowing warm breeze. 2. Game exercise: Jump to the palm of your hand. Purpose: to teach children to jump on two legs in height. 3. Role-playing game: Family Purpose: to promote the desire of children to independently select toys and attributes for the game, use substitute objects. 4. D / i: Find and name Purpose: to develop the ability, according to the verbal instructions of the teacher, to find objects and name them, their color, size, shape. 5. P / n: Through the stream. Purpose: to consolidate the ability of children to walk on an inclined board, while maintaining balance. 6. Drawing in the sand with your finger. Sun. Purpose: to develop the imagination of children, to consolidate the ability to draw rounded shapes. 7. Independent physical activity. Purpose: to educate in children the desire to perform physical. walking exercises.

    Observation: for the polynya.
    Purpose: to introduce wormwood, to disassemble its structure, to talk about medicinal properties. Develop children's knowledge of plants, respect.
    The course of observation: wormwood was popularly called: Chernobyl, wormwood grass, widow's grass, serpentine, God's tree, steppe Chimka. Wormwood is one of our bitterest plants. Wormwood in Slavic plants was attributed miraculous power. In Russia, on the eve of the holiday of Ivan Kupala, people girded themselves with Chernobyl, putting wreaths from it on their heads; it should have been whole year to protect from diseases, witchcraft and encounters with monsters.
    Artistic word: Borka ate wormwood instead of milk. Tanya shouted: “throw! Spit out the bitter wormwood."

    Card filetargetedwalkssummer.

    Targeted walks are short-term, and a small amount of tasks are solved on them. Children meet bright natural phenomena this or that season: nesting birds, ice drift. There are targeted walks to the reservoir, to the meadow. You can choose one object for observation on the site of the kindergarten, for example, a birch, and make targeted walks in different seasons, observing and noting the changes that have occurred.

    Walk to the flower garden.

    Introduce children to the flowers growing in the flower garden.

    To acquaint children with the structure of a flower: stem, leaves, flowers, roots, has a smell.

    Cultivate respect for plants.

    Invite the children to inspect the flower bed.

    Asters, calendula, dahlias, nasturtium, marigolds grow in our flower garden.

    Draw the attention of children to the fact that the plant has a root, stem, leaves, flowers.

    What is the root for? (absorb moisture) nutrients.)

    What is the stem for? (to carry nutrients to the leaves.)

    What are the leaves for? (to absorb light.)

    Carefully consider with the children the shape and color of the flowers, pay attention to their beauty.

    Who helps plants grow? (sun, rain, earth, people.)

    How do people help grow? (water, loosen the ground near them, destroy weeds.)

    Plants have grown because the flower bed is a good "home" for them, in which there is nutritious soil, water, light, warmth, because people help them grow.

    All these plants do not die in the fall, but simply fall asleep for a long winter, in order to come to life again in the spring, begin to grow and bloom. In one place they grow for many years.

    Why do we need flowers? (to please people with its beauty.)

    Let's take care of the flowers, let them decorate our site, our kindergarten, our city, our Earth.
